How Artificial Intelligence Benefits Contact Center Agents and Enhances Customer Experience

Artificial Intelligence (AI) has been a topic of curiosity since the classic movie, 2001: A Space Odyssey. But what exactly is AI and how can it help in a contact center environment?

Put simply, AI is an advanced application that uses real-time data and leading algorithms to solve problems. It is essentially a more evolved form of chatbots. AI can offer several operational tools, such as voice recognition, chat programs, analytics tools, and sentiment analysis software.

There are benefits of AI for both digital employee experience (DEX) and customer experience (CX). For DEX, AI can manage simple customer requests and offer real-time data to agents during customer interactions. On the CX side, AI provides self-service options, 24/7 assistance, personalized experiences, faster solutions, and less friction.

However, AI is not a replacement for human interaction. You still need human agents to solve problems and to meet customers’ needs. Additionally, it requires a quality engineer and CX leaders to optimize the benefits of AI.

If you’re considering implementing AI into your contact center, make sure to build a plan that identifies business outcomes to achieve with AI. Decide on a vendor or app, identify product owners who can keep track of the tool, and provide training to your team on how to use it effectively.
